| 61754. |
What is fuming nitric acid |
| Answer» When the solution contains more than 86% HNO3, it is referred to as fuming nitric acid. Depending on the amount of nitrogen dioxide present, fuming nitric acid is further characterized as white fuming nitric acid or red fuming nitric acid, at concentrations above 95%. | |

| 61758. |
How does urine formed |
| Answer» Glomerular filtration is the first step in urine formation. Blood comes to the kidney via the renal artery, branches into even smaller arteries and eventually into the afferent arteriole. The afferent arteriole feeds into the glomerulus, providing the blood for the glomerular capillaries.As the blood travels through these capillaries, filtration causes a lot of the plasma contents to spill out. They spill out of the glomerular capillaries which end up within the glomerular capsule. The glomerular capsule is continuous with the rest of the renal tubules. The solution that spills out in the renal corpuscle is the solution that we will clean out to make urine. | |

| 61788. |
How is resistence different from resistivity |
| Answer» The opposition to the flow of electrons by the conductor is resistance . Resistance offered by the conductor having unit length and unit area of cross section is resistivity | |
